Autos: Swiss bank Credit Suisse quits F1 team BMW Sauber

Associated Press

ZURICH, Switzerland — Swiss bank Credit Suisse Group is stopping its sponsorship of Formula One team BMW Sauber.

Switzerland's second biggest bank said Monday it decided against renewing a contract that ended last year.

Credit Suisse had sponsored the team since 2001, sticking with the Swiss Sauber team when it was taken over by German automaker BMW in 2005.

Credit Suisse said it was concentrating now on sponsoring regional events and institutions, instead of international ones. It cited its past support of the New York Philharmonic and the National Gallery in London.

BMW Sauber won its first race last year at the Canadian Grand Prix, with Robert Kubica crossing the line ahead of teammate Nick Heidfeld. The team finished the season third behind Ferrari and McLaren-Mercedes.
